Transaction 8ebc4fb961fd896ff52b3131f32940990853841c9c426e07bf374cc40adf3a29
1 Input
1 Output
-
8ebc4fb961fd896ff52b3131f32940990853841c9c426e07bf374cc40adf3a29:0
- value
- 185750
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a94f4eafd154e80f277dc196a7d92c6ea1bba756 OP_EQUAL
- address
- 3H8F8LRqAGgdAiTf4CXfx8zJ28LKFyjyLy